About

Your puppy has special nutritional needs. Rest assured that you can meet all your pup’s dietary requirements, effortlessly.

Precious pups need higher protein, fat and energy levels for optimal growth and development. OLYMPIC® PROFESSIONAL PUPPY offers just that, with the added peace of mind of gastrointestinal sensitivity control. OLYMPIC® PROFESSIONAL PUPPY is the smart choice for small to medium-sized dogs.

Product Features
  • For small to medium breed puppies, with special attention to growth and development. Ideal calcium and phosphorous ratios to maintain bone and cartilage health.
  • OLYMPIC® PROFESSIONAL PUPPY is a sensitivity-controlled formula as it has no artificial flavours, colours or preservatives and contains no soya, pork, beef or fish meal. Poultry (made up of chicken, turkey and duck only) is its only source of animal protein.
  • All-natural ingredients with added vitamins and minerals, making it 100% balanced and nutritionally complete.
  • DHA is a natural source of longchain omega-3 fatty acids.
  • Inulin is a prebiotic and reduces offensive faecal odour while assisting to modulate intestinal irregularities.
  • Beet pulp is a prebiotic and is a source of both fermentable and non-fermentable fibre.
  • Zeolite increases digestive safety, absorbs toxic agents in the gastrointestinal tract, reduces flatulence, as well as improving the odour and consistency of stools.
